African Nations Cup - Egypt 1 Tunisia 0

First Published: Jan 25, 2002

Egypt defeated World Cup finalists Tunisia 1-0 and reach the last eight of the African Nations Cup if they beat 'flu-ridden Zambia.

Midfielder Hazem Emam scored the winner in the first half when the Egyptians were well on top.

But Egypt improved after the break and had a Jamel Zabi goal disallowed for offside in the 50th minute with Zouberi Baya free kick forcing goalkeeper Essam El-Hadary to save and keep Egypt's lead four minutes later.

Khaled el-Amin almost added to the score when he hit the post late on but it was Emam who hit the crucial strike.

Mohamed Barakat crossed from the byline for Emam to hit a low finish after controlling the ball and adjusting his weight at the far post and leave Tunisia needing to beat Senegal next week to progress.
